Pavers Service in Fairfield County, CT
Pavers services encompass the installation, repair, and replacement of durable stone or concrete paving materials used to create attractive and functional outdoor surfaces. These projects often include driveways, walkways, patios, and outdoor seating areas, providing both aesthetic appeal and practical durability. Homeowners typically seek paver services to enhance curb appeal, define outdoor living spaces, or address issues like uneven surfaces, cracking, or shifting that can occur over time. Understanding the types of materials available, such as natural stone or concrete pavers, as well as the scope of work involved, can help property owners make informed decisions for their outdoor projects.
Before requesting pavers services, property owners should consider factors like the desired design style, the intended use of the paved area, and maintenance requirements. It’s important to evaluate the existing landscape and drainage conditions to ensure proper installation and longevity of the paved surfaces. Clarifying project goals, budget, and preferred materials can streamline the process and lead to results that complement the property's overall aesthetic. Proper planning and understanding of the scope can help ensure a durable, visually appealing outcome for outdoor spaces.

Pavers Service Questions
What types of projects do paver services cover? Paver services typically include driveways, walkways, patios, and outdoor steps, enhancing both function and appearance of outdoor spaces.
Are pavers a durable choice for outdoor surfaces? Yes, pavers are known for their strength and resistance to cracking, making them suitable for high-traffic and weather-exposed areas.
What materials are used for paver installations?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different styles and durability options.
How should property owners prepare for paver installation? Clear the area of debris and existing surfaces, and discuss design preferences to ensure proper installation and results.
